Transaction 84bf591544b5b21e8de34013bc7a594c258654f8c91b53dd597f257d7137e8c4
1 Input
1 Output
-
84bf591544b5b21e8de34013bc7a594c258654f8c91b53dd597f257d7137e8c4:0
- value
- 4995779
- script pubkey
- OP_0 OP_PUSHBYTES_20 be015fca682f27f4ff31bf57ef4f9675705fa198
- address
- bc1qhcq4ljng9unlfle3hat77nukw4c9lgvcggfeme